I used to own the Black Diamond Covert Winter Pack. The integrated Avalung is definitely a sick tool. This is a great pack to take up if you're planning on doing some hiking or skiing out of bounds, or even for short BC tours. I owned the older 22L pack in a L/XL (6'1, 175), which was a bit small for my taste, but the 32L, or the newer 30L, is a great do it all pack. The ski carry is awesome, adding a lot of stability over other packs I have used, and fits HUDGE skis (my Fatypus Alotta's, 140mm waist with a twin, fit tightly but well). Definitely the go to pack for day trips and sidecountry yoyoing. It even doubles as a summer hike/bike pack!
